Question
Simplifies- (1 + tan²A) + (1+ 1 /tan²A)
[A] 1/ (sin²A-sin4 A) [C] 1/ (cos2 A-sin4 A) [B] 1/ (sin²A-cos4 A) [D]1/ (cot2 A-tan4 A)Solution
(1+ tan² A) + (1+1/ tan²A) First, we know that: 1 + tan² A= sec² A Also, for the second term: 1+1/ tan² A = 1 + cot² A = csc²A Now, adding these two expressions: sec² A + csc² A =(sin2A+cos2A)/Sin2A.cos2A =1/ ( Sin2A.cos2A) = 1/ (Sin2A (1- Sin2A) =1/ (Sin2A- Sin4A).
